Understanding Gamification


Gamification uses game design techniques in non-gaming contexts to boost participation, motivation, and enjoyment. This approach proves particularly effective in sports, where additional incentives may encourage people to take part. By adding elements such as scoring, competitions, and rewards, you can create a vibrant and interactive environment for participants.


Research shows that adding gamified elements can lead to a 30% increase in participation rates in physical activities. This enhanced experience does not just cater to the young; it encourages people of all ages to engage more actively in sports.


Scoring Systems


Introducing scoring systems is one of the easiest ways to gamify sports. Similar to video games, participants can earn points for various achievements, such as completing a task or scoring a goal.


For example, in a basketball game, apart from standard point scoring, players could earn bonus points for hitting three-pointers or making five assists in a match. This not only motivates individual performance but also fosters teamwork. Studies show that teams who understand their scoring systems see a 25% improvement in collaboration on the field.


Additionally, in a gamified soccer setup, consider organizing community events like weekend soccer tournaments. Teams could accrue points over several matches, culminating in a championship at the season's end. This creates a dynamic and engaging environment, sparking friendly competition among participants.


Rewards and Incentives

Incorporating rewards and incentives can further enhance the gamification process. These can take different forms—like digital badges, trophies, a spot on the leaderboard, or even tangible items such as gift cards or sports gear.


Offering incentives can significantly influence motivation. An example might be giving participants who complete ten workouts, get a branded t-shirt or a discount at a local sports store. According to surveys, 68% of participants say they are more likely to continue an activity if there are rewards tied to achievements.


Additionally, collaborating with local businesses can create an engaging community events & enhance the brands spirit. Consider offering discounts at restaurants or fitness centers for those who reach specific fitness milestones involved in a gamified AR app.




Integrating Augmented Reality (AR)


Augmented Reality (AR) offers an incredible way to enrich physical activities. By overlaying digital elements in the real world, AR enhances engagement and interaction in sports.


Imagine playing soccer with animated graphics that display score multipliers or celebratory effects for outstanding goals. Using AR development tools, programmers can create environments that blend seamlessly with real-world activities.


For instance, participants might use an app that tracks their goals, suggests personalized drills based on performance analytics, and displays progress in real time. This level of engagement can increase interest and excitement around sports, welcoming both novice players and seasoned athletes.

Holographic Technology for Gamifying Sports


One of the latest advancements in gamification is holographic technology, which offers an entirely new level of interactivity in sports and physical activities. Holographic projections can create immersive environments, interactive training sessions, and even real-time game enhancements.

How Holograms Elevate Sports & Activities:

  • Virtual Opponents & Teammates: Holographic AI opponents can be projected onto the field or court, allowing players to train against dynamic, adaptive opponents.

  • Interactive Coaching: Coaches can use holograms to demonstrate techniques in 3D space, making training more engaging and easier to understand.

  • Immersive Game Modes: Imagine soccer, basketball or hockey matches where holographic obstacles appear dynamically, forcing players to adapt their strategy in real-time.

  • Enhanced Spectator Engagement: Spectators can view real-time player stats and play breakdowns in holographic form, making the experience more interactive.

For example, a gamified boxing ring could feature a holographic scoreboard floating above the fighters, displaying real-time stats like punch accuracy, stamina, and reaction time and or auto calculating a win percentage. This not only enhances the player experience but also makes the event more engaging for the audience.

By integrating holographic projections, sports organizers can create futuristic and highly engaging environments that push the boundaries of traditional gameplay.
